Disciples of All Nations: How Cross Cultural Interns Are Advancing the Great Commission

Seika (Portugal) As a student from Japan who attended the Bible Institute in New York and is completing CCI in Portugal, Seika Ito loves getting to expe- rience other cultures and people groups. When describing the events leading up to where she is now, Seika emphasizes how God gave her the desire to pursue CCI and opened doors for her to go. “I wanted to not just learn about ministry, but also experience it. I also wanted to learn how to do ministry in another country, because my first purpose for coming to the states was to see Christianity in a different country.” Because CCI gives students the opportunity to gain ministry experience and learn how to share the gospel in other cultures, this was the perfect fit for her. Seika is currently in her second year of CCI in Portugal. Her responsibilities look different every day, from helping at youth events to playing musical instruments for worship ministry and even capturing stories through photography and social media. “I’ve learned a lot about commu- nication and being intentional with people,” she shares. “I have no idea how I could do ministry without this type of experience.” She sees this learning process as vital to preparing for a life of service to the Lord. She is excited to take what she has learned through CCI back to Japan, where she will continue serving the Lord through local church ministry.

Matthew 28:19–20 records Jesus’s closing words to His disciples in what is one of the most well-known passages in all Scripture: “Go therefore and make disciples of all nations…” Word of Life brings its unique emphasis on youth evangelism into this calling, building bridges for the gospel into the hearts of children and youth around the world. There is one particularly unique and effective strategy Word of Life is using to advance the good news on a global scale. Through a program called the Cross Cultural Internship (CCI), Bible Institute graduates spend two years working with full-time missionaries on an international field while completing their degree online. The lives of those who have been part of the internship give overwhelming evidence that this short-term opportunity is a catalyst for long-term furtherance of the gospel worldwide.
